An exciting new opportunity has come up here at Newport as we’re on the lookout for a Master Technician to join our dynamic team.

As a Master Technician you will diagnose complex systems across the whole range of vehicle systems, as well as routine service and repairs. We believe in developing YOU, providing a supportive and engaging place to work and offering training opportunities that keep you up to date with all the latest technologies to progress your career with us.

A Master Technician will also:

  • Diagnose complex symptoms across the whole range of vehicle systems, as well as conduct routine service & repairs.
  • Ensure Quality and a first time fix to delight our customers every time.
  • Communicate with customers to fully understand their reported issue.
  • Feedback resolutions to the Stellantis technical platforms.
  • Develop your skills & knowledge to stay at the forefront of vehicle technology, including EV.
  • Lead by example continually demonstrating best practice to your colleagues.
  • Assist and train your colleagues with technical assistance.
  • Complete video vehicle health checks to highlight any issues & sell-up opportunities.
  • Maintain a clean & safe work bay.

A Day in the Life of a Master Technician:

I start my day by checking bookings for the near future where I make contact prior to the visit to gather more information to speed up the repair process on the day of booking. I then go to workshop control to collect my first job of the day, as a Master Technician I get involved with the majority of diagnostics appointments whereby the customer reports a fault and I am to determine the cause and what is required to rectify the problem, when parts have been delivered I then complete the repairs.

Whilst doing this level of work I will task my apprentice with tasks such as checking the vehicles tyre pressures and carrying out vehicle health checks.

Not every day is the same for me but I like to keep a structure in place, I love the challenge of the role and the tests that it brings even after 36 years of employment.
